An attorney for mesothelioma will also be able to determine the most appropriate legal claim for their clients. There are four types of mesothelioma lawsuits which include personal injury lawsuits; wrongful-death lawsuits asbestos trust fund claims and mesothelioma VA lawsuits. Personal injury lawsuits can be filed by mesothelioma patients or their family members in order to receive an amount of money from companies who are responsible for their asbestos exposure. Family members of victims who have died due to asbestos exposure are able to file wrongful death lawsuits on behalf of their estate.

Asbestos trusts are created by asbestos companies that have been bankrupted or dissolved to pay claims for asbestos-related illnesses. Settlements or jury awards are generally used to settle these claims. Veterans who are diagnosed as having an asbestos-related illness such as mesothelioma are eligible for VA benefits.
